Handover Note — Director Transition, Larkspur Subscriptions

To branch managers, from the outgoing director to the incoming one: the new Larkspur Select tier is fully scoped, with pricing approved and billing changes tested at the Redmoor branch. Please brief counter staff carefully, as Select replaces the old annual pass for new sign-ups only; existing holders keep current terms. Training packs arrive next week. The commercial reasoning is summarised confidentially below.

management briefing: Only 3 of the 120 pilot accounts renewed Quenath, so a churn review is set for April 1.

# Approvals — Inkfall Rendering Pipeline

Quick reminder for release folks: any change to the Inkfall markdown pipeline needs an approval before it ships, even "tiny" tweaks to the sanitizer. We learned this the hard way when a one-line regex change broke tables across every Lanternview doc site for a weekend. Process is simple: open a change request, attach before/after renders of the golden sample docs, and wait for the green check. Final approval authority for all pipeline releases rests with the person named below.

approver of bajeg-bajef = Istion Pelys Holax Wenox

Ticket #: open
Site: Marwick House, floor 2
Issue: First-aid room door closer slamming; also keypad backlight dead, hard to read in corridor lighting.
Reported by: team assistant, Delvane Partners
Priority: High — room must stay accessible during business hours.
Action needed: adjust closer tension, replace keypad unit. Supplies restock not affected; cabinet checked Monday.
Note for assistants covering while repair is pending: door may stick, push firmly at the top corner. Until the new keypad is fitted, enter using the code below.

staff pass of kawip-hawef = bdg-QLP-2